Formulae Protons = Z = 8 Neutrons = A − Z Electrons in neutral atom = Z = 8 Group number of oxygen = 16 (group 16 = chalcogens) Isotope notation: $^A_Z X$ Calculate for each isotope (i) Oxygen-16 Protons = 8 Neutrons = 16 − 8 = 8 Electrons = 8 Group = 16 Symbol:$^{16}_8O$ ​ (ii) Oxygen-17 Protons = 8 Neutrons = 17 − 8 = 9 Electrons = 8 Group = 16 Symbol: $^{17}_8O$ ​ (iii) Oxygen-18 Protons = 8 Neutrons = 18 − 8 = 10 Electrons = 8 Group = 16 Symbol: $^{18}_8O$ ​
